Real-World Applications of Blockchain in Industrial Systems

Supply Chain Management

Imagine a world where you can trace the origin of your coffee beans right from the farm to your cup. Blockchain makes this possible by recording every transaction and movement, thereby increasing traceability and reducing fraud.

Quality Assurance

Did someone say zero-defect manufacturing? Blockchain's immutable nature can keep an indelible record of quality checks, providing the perfect quality assurance tool.

Smart Contracts

As mysterious as they sound, smart contracts are just automated contracts that self-execute when conditions are met. These digital agreements can streamline processes and save a ton of paperwork.

Asset Lifecycle Management

Blockchain can help track an asset throughout its lifecycle, providing critical insights that can aid in timely maintenance, accurate valuation, and efficient utilization.

Challenges Faced in Blockchain Integration and Possible Solutions

Scalability Issue

As the size of the blockchain grows, the resource requirements increase. But with sharding techniques and Layer 2 solutions, this obstacle can be overcome.

Security Concerns

While blockchain itself is secure, the applications built on it might not be. A robust development process can mitigate these risks.

Regulatory Challenges

Navigating the regulatory landscape can be like finding your way out of a maze blindfolded. However, increasing collaboration between tech companies and regulatory bodies could lead to clarity and smoother integration.
